About Arts in April 2017 Programming
This year’s event will focus on Napa Valley’s greatest public assets: 
the vibrancy of each city’s downtown districts. The city centers of Calistoga, St. Helena, Yountville, Napa, and American Canyon will be highlighted, bringing the community together to celebrate the authentic spirit and heritage of the area.
